本文介绍了如何利用网络爬虫技术搭建蜘蛛池,并通过合法手段实现盈利。文章详细讲解了蜘蛛池的概念、搭建步骤、注意事项以及盈利模式,包括采集数据、分析数据、销售数据等。文章还强调了合法合规的重要性,提醒读者不要触碰法律红线。通过本文的指导,读者可以了解并尝试搭建自己的蜘蛛池,实现网络赚钱的梦想。
在数字时代,互联网成为了信息交流的海洋,而在这片海洋中,有一种名为“蜘蛛”的虚拟生物,它们悄无声息地穿梭于各个网站之间,收集数据、分析趋势,甚至通过这一行为创造了巨大的商业价值,这便是“蜘蛛池”的概念,一个集中管理和优化网络爬虫(即网络蜘蛛)的平台,通过合法合规的方式挖掘数据价值,实现盈利,本文将深入探讨蜘蛛池搭建的技术细节、法律风险、盈利模式以及如何通过这一技术实现盈利。
一、蜘蛛池基础概念解析
1.1 什么是网络爬虫?
网络爬虫,又称网络蜘蛛或网络机器人,是一种自动化程序,能够自动浏览互联网上的网页,并收集数据,这些数据可以包括文本、图片、链接等,广泛应用于搜索引擎、数据分析、市场研究等领域。
1.2 蜘蛛池的定义
蜘蛛池是一个管理和优化多个网络爬虫的平台,通过统一的接口和策略,实现对多个爬虫的集中控制、资源分配、任务调度和数据收集,它旨在提高爬虫的效率、降低维护成本,并保障爬虫的合法性。
二、蜘蛛池搭建技术详解
2.1 架构设计与关键技术
分布式架构:为了提高爬虫的效率和稳定性,蜘蛛池通常采用分布式架构,将任务分配到多个节点上执行。
任务调度:使用任务队列(如RabbitMQ、Kafka)实现任务的分发和调度,确保每个节点都能均衡地获取任务。
数据解析:利用正则表达式、XPath、CSS选择器等技术解析网页数据。
数据存储:采用数据库(如MySQL、MongoDB)或分布式文件系统(如HDFS)存储收集到的数据。
反爬虫机制:为了应对网站的反爬虫策略,需要实现IP代理池、请求头伪装等功能。
2.2 搭建步骤
1、环境准备:安装Python、Node.js等编程环境,以及必要的库和框架(如Scrapy、BeautifulSoup)。
2、设计爬虫框架:确定爬虫的架构和模块(如URL管理器、数据解析器、数据存储模块)。
3、编写爬虫代码:根据目标网站的结构编写解析和抓取代码。
4、部署爬虫:将爬虫代码部署到服务器上,并配置好任务调度系统。
5、监控与优化:通过监控工具(如Prometheus)监控爬虫的运行状态,并根据需要进行优化。
三、法律风险与合规性探讨
在利用蜘蛛池进行数据采集时,必须严格遵守相关法律法规,特别是《中华人民共和国网络安全法》和《个人信息保护法》等,以下是一些常见的合规要求:
合法授权:在采集数据前,必须获得网站所有者的明确授权。
隐私保护:不得采集个人隐私信息,如姓名、身份证号等。
合理使用:采集的数据只能用于合法的商业用途,不得用于非法活动。
数据脱敏:对采集的数据进行脱敏处理,保护用户隐私。
定期审计:定期对采集的数据进行审计,确保合规性。
四、蜘蛛池的盈利模式与案例分析
4.1 盈利模式
1、数据销售:将采集到的数据卖给需要的企业或机构,如市场调研公司、广告公司等。
2、广告服务:在采集到的数据中插入广告,通过广告收入盈利。
3、API服务:提供API接口,供用户查询和使用采集到的数据。
4、数据分析服务:对采集到的数据进行深度分析,提供定制化的数据分析报告。
5、软件销售:将开发的爬虫软件和蜘蛛池平台卖给其他企业或个人。
4.2 案例分析
案例一:电商数据分析:某电商公司利用蜘蛛池采集竞争对手的商品信息、价格等,通过数据分析优化自己的商品策略,提高销售额。
案例二:市场研究:某市场研究公司利用蜘蛛池采集行业报告、新闻资讯等,为客户提供定制化的市场分析报告。
案例三:金融数据分析:某金融公司利用蜘蛛池采集股市数据、财经新闻等,通过数据分析预测市场趋势,提高投资决策的准确性。
五、未来趋势与展望
随着大数据和人工智能技术的不断发展,蜘蛛池的应用场景将越来越广泛,我们可以期待以下几个趋势:
智能化升级:通过引入AI技术,提高爬虫的智能性和效率,利用深度学习技术自动识别和解析网页结构。
云端化部署:将蜘蛛池部署在云端,实现更高的可扩展性和灵活性,使用AWS Lambda等无服务器架构运行爬虫。
合规性增强:随着法律法规的完善,未来的蜘蛛池将更加注重合规性,通过技术手段实现数据的合法采集和使用,引入区块链技术保障数据的不可篡改性和可追溯性。
生态化建设:构建以蜘蛛池为核心的生态系统,吸引更多的开发者、企业和机构加入,共同推动数据采集和分析行业的发展,建立数据共享平台、开发者社区等。
蜘蛛池作为一种高效的数据采集工具,正在逐渐改变着我们的生活和商业模式,在利用这一技术时,我们必须时刻牢记合规性和道德责任的重要性,只有合法合规地利用这一技术才能为人类社会带来真正的价值,希望本文能为读者提供一个全面而深入的视角来理解和应用蜘蛛池技术实现盈利目标的同时也能关注其潜在的风险和挑战确保技术的可持续发展和合理利用。